Wont to, Due to, and Bound to
I started this worksheet to practice "wont to do" and "as was his wont" because it has come up in some texts I have used with my advanced groups. I decided it would be a good idea to review "due to" and "bound to" also, as sometimes all three could be used, depending on the meaning. The answers are on the back.

Saying Sorry and Responding (and famous quotes quiz)
First of all there is a little worksheet to look at vocabulary connected to apologising. There�s also a collocations part and mini role-play. After that there is a famous person quotes game that could be done as a quiz (teams or pairs) or just a drill for modal verbs. Answers included.

Alternatives to Problem
A short explanation of the different ways to express the noun "problem" in English in technical situations. I did this for my engineers but it can easily be changed for less technical contexts. There is a dice game to help the students practice and a second page with more practice sentences.
